Journalist and organizer Ashraful Kabir Asif has turned 46. He was born on January 27, 1981, in a respectable Muslim family in Shyampur, Sadar Upazila of Gaibandha district. His father, the late Abdullahel Kabir, was a retired senior principal officer of Rupali Bank Limited. Asif spent his childhood and adolescence in Bogra due to his father’s work.

Ashraful Kabir Asif, who has a record of achievements in education and career, passed his SSC in 1997 from Bogra Zilla School and HSC in 1999 from Government Azizul Haque College. Later, he completed his honors and masters from the Department of Mass Communication and Journalism of Rajshahi University.

In 2006, he started his formal career as a sub-editor and columnist of the newspaper ‘Dainik Jaya Zaydin’ under the editorship of renowned journalist Shafiq Rehman. After that, he joined television journalism. In addition to serving as the joint news editor on Baishakhi Television, he hosted the popular live talk show ‘CDL Sangbad Saradin’. After that, he successfully served as the news editor for a long time on RTV and ATN Bangla. In 2022, he was awarded the ‘Best News Editor’ award by ATN Bangla. Since January 1, 2023, he has been serving as the editor and publisher of ‘Bangladesh Global’.

Along with journalism, Ashraful Kabir Asif is also well-known as an organizer. He has served as the general secretary of the Rangpur Division Journalists’ Association, Dhaka (RDJA) and the joint secretary of the Online Newsportal Association Bangladesh (ONAB). He is also working as the general secretary of the Freelancers Association of Bangladesh and the member secretary of the Gaibandha Sadar Upazila Samity, Dhaka. He is one of the founding members of the Bogra First Division Cricket League team ‘Zia Memorial Club’. In his personal life, he is the father of a son.
